Tender description

This project is part of the Darent Valley Landscape Partnership Scheme (DVLPS). DVLPS is a five-year project funded primarily by the National Lottery Heritage Fund (NLHF) and delivered through the Kent Downs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ty Unit. The scheme aims to encourage local people and visitors to conserve, enhance and celebrate the natural beauty and heritage of the Darent Valley, and to ensure its survival for future generations. The Inspired Palmer Landscapes project plays a key role within the entire scheme and will be delivered throughout the length and breadth of the scheme area. It will work across communities within the valley to explore, reveal and celebrate the stories of individual places and local landscapes. Creative workshop events will draw together communities and individuals of all ages to investigate the history that has shaped the Darent Valley and created the sense of place for their part of it. Stories will be communicated through a variety of creative forms, inspired by Samuel Palmer’s connection with the valley. This will then be celebrated through a celebration event to enable the wider community to enjoy and learn about the Darent Valley’s heritage and celebrate their own heritage connections to the landscape. The focus of the project will be on enhancing community pride and joint-working between the individual settlements that are located within the valley. It will be a celebration of the communities, land and how interaction created the distinctive landscape of the Darent Valley. The project intends to be entirely inclusive and provide opportunities for all sections of the individual communities to be involved from school children to adults.
